India Hiring Monkey Handlers to Protect BWF World Championships Venue

Ahead of the Badminton World Federation (BWF) World Championships, the Badminton Association of India faced unexpected logistical challenges at the venue in New Delhi, India, drawing sharp scrutiny from players and fans over unusual on-site conditions, including local wildlife interference.

As elite players prepared to compete on the international stage, reports detailed unusual occurrences at the tournament facilities. According to coverage surrounding the event, tournament organizers took steps to address the presence of wild animals near the competition areas, hiring specialized personnel to manage wildlife control.

Logistical Hurdles and Wildlife Control at the Venue

Preparing a major international badminton venue requires precise temperature control, lighting calibration, and court security. However, preparations in New Delhi involved unconventional measures. According to local reports, the Badminton Association of India deployed extra personnel to deter local wildlife—specifically monkeys—from entering the tournament grounds.

Venues across South Asia occasionally encounter local fauna, but high-profile sports tournaments require strict environmental management to ensure athlete safety and fair play. The presence of animals near training and match courts prompted commentary across sports media channels regarding venue readiness for a world-class BWF fixture.
